One of the most common problems that can be encountered with uPVC windows is that they become difficult to lock or open. This issue usually occurs when the locking system has become stiff or sluggish. If this is the case, a simple fix is to use graphite powder or machine oil to lubricate the handle and lock mechanism. This will allow for the mechanism to be freed up and the window or door to work normally again.

Another issue that often arises with uPVC windows is that the hinges get stiff or stuck. This is usually caused by grit and dust building on the hinges. Lubricating the hinges with oil or grease is the solution. The wrong type of lubricant could harm the hinges, rendering them unusable.

Stained Glass Repairs

Stained glass windows are located in homes, churches and other structures. They provide visual interest and provide privacy to a space. They are fragile and require regular maintenance to ensure they are in good shape. Even with the best care, stained and leaded glass windows degrade over time due to age and exposure to weather and other environmental factors. This can cause cracks, fade, and water leakage. It is crucial to seek out an expert in your area to restore your stained or leaded window to its original beauty.

The average cost to repair damaged or cracked stained-glass is $500. The exact cost will depend on the kind of solution needed to fix the issue. For instance professionals may employ cop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ing to repair the glass that has broken. They can also relead lead cames and seal stained glass. There are a variety of alternatives, each with its own advantages and costs. The best solution will depend on the size of the crack, location and UPVC Window Repairs Near Me the kind of material used to make the glass.

Leaded glass cracks can be caused by vibration, thermal expansion and contraction, movement of the building, or simply normal wear and tear. As time passes, cracks may develop and cause more issues. To prevent further damage and enlargement the crack that is located across the face of stained-glass panels or their face must be repaired as soon as is possible. Years ago, this was commonly accomplished by splicing an "Dutchman" lead flange over the crack. This was a poor method of repair and is no longer the case. There are much better ways to fix these types cracks.

Stained glass restoration is a highly specialized art that can come in many forms. It can be as easy as repairing a crack, or as complicated as restoring a stained glass door panel or window to its original condition. In general, the cost for a complete restoration is much higher than an easy repair. The work includes cleaning and getting rid of damaged glass, securing lead cames, resealing cement and re-tying it and replacing stained glass pieces that are missing.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ping blocks air and water from entering homes through the gaps that surround windows and doors. It's a crucial part of home maintenance, and can help avoid the need for expensive repairs or energy bills, as as make a home more comfortable. The materials used to make the seal may degrade over time, due to wear and tears. It is important to replace these materials regularly.

There are a few indicators that your weather stripping is beginning to wear down: a damp area after washing the window and a whistling sound driving along the street or drafts that may be felt in front of an unlocked door. These are all good indications to find a Tasker in my area who can repair your weatherstripping.

Taskers can seal your windows and door with a variety of weatherstripping materials. Foam tapes can be made from closed cell or open-cell foam. They are available in various sizes, thicknesses, and widths. These are easy-to-install and are easily cut with scissors. Felt strips are inexpensive and last for at least a year. You can cut them to size with scissors, and attach them to the door frame either on the hinge side or sliding windows using staples, glue, or tacks. Metal or vinyl V-strips are slightly more difficult to put in place however they can be nailed into place along a window jamb.

Fogging of the glass is a typical problem with double-paned window. This is due to a breakdown of the airtight seal that joins the two panes of glass. Re-sealing the glass could be able to fix the issue, based on the root cause. If the window has been exposed for a prolonged time to elements, it might be necessary replace the entire unit.
